This counter contains the number of transmitted frames that
encountered one collision.
This counter contains the number of transmitted frames that
encountered more than one collision.
This counter contains the total number of collisions that were
encountered while attempting to transmit. This count includes
late collisions and frames that encountered MAXCOL.
This counter contains the number of frames that were
received properly from the link. It is updated only after the
actual reception from the link is completed and all the data
bytes are stored in memory.
This counter contains the number of aligned frames discarded
because of a CRC error. This counter is updated, if needed,
regardless of the Receive Unit state. The Receive CRC Errors
counter is mutually exclusive of the Receive Alignment Errors
and Receive Short Frame Errors counters.
This counter contains the number of frames that are both
misaligned (for example, CRS de-asserts on a non-octal
boundary) and contain a CRC error. The counter is updated, if
needed, regardless of the Receive Unit state. The Receive
Alignment Errors counter is mutually exclusive of the Receive
CRC Errors and Receive Short Frame Errors counters.
This counter contains the number of good frames discarded
due to unavailability of resources. Frames intended for a host
whose Receive Unit is in the No Resources state fall into this
category. If the 82559 is configured to Save Bad Frames and
the status of the received frame indicates that it is a bad
frame, the Receive Resource Errors counter is not updated.
This counter contains the number of frames known to be lost
because the local system bus was not available. If the traffic
problem persists for more than one frame, the frames that
follow the first are also lost; however, because there is no lost
frame indicator, they are not counted.
This counter contains the number of frames that encountered
collisions during frame reception.
This counter contains the number of received frames that are
shorter than the minimum frame length. The Receive Short
Frame Errors counter is mutually exclusive to the Receive
Alignment Errors and Receive CRC Errors counters. A short
frame will always increment only the Receive Short Frame
Errors counter.
This counter contains the number of Flow Control frames
transmitted by the 82559. This count includes both the Xoff
frames transmitted and Xon (PAUSE(0)) frames transmitted.
This counter contains the number of Flow Control frames
received by the 82559. This count includes both the Xoff
frames received and Xon (PAUSE(0)) frames received.
